Dr Des: Focus on YOU – Insomnia.

What is Insomnia?
Insomnia is when you aren’t sleeping as you should. That can mean you aren’t sleeping enough, you aren’t sleeping well or you’re having trouble falling or staying asleep. For some people, insomnia is a minor inconvenience. For others, insomnia can be a major disruption. The reasons why insomnia happens can vary just as widely.
Because you need sleep to be your best, disruptions like insomnia commonly cause symptoms that affect you while you’re awake. These include:
• Feeling tired, unwell or sleepy.
• Delayed responses, such as reacting too slowly when you’re driving.
• Trouble remembering things.
• Slowed thought processes, confusion or trouble concentrating.
• Mood disruptions, especially anxiety, depression and irritability.
• Other disruptions in your work, social activities, hobbies or other routine activities.

Dr Des: Focus on YOU - Weight Loss Benefits.

Physical Benefits

1. Better Cardiovascular Health

Reduced Heart Disease Risk: Weight loss reduces the strain on the heart, lowers cholesterol levels, and helps regulate blood pressure, decreasing the risk of heart attacks, strokes, and other cardiovascular diseases.
Improved Blood Circulation: A healthier body weight allows for better blood flow, reducing the burden on your circulatory system.

2. Improved Metabolism

Better Insulin Sensitivity: Weight loss often improves insulin sensitivity, helping to control blood sugar levels more effectively and reducing the risk of type 2 diabetes.
Faster Fat Burning: As you lose weight, your body can become more efficient at burning fat, boosting your metabolism.

3. Joint and Musculoskeletal Health

Reduced Joint Stress: Carrying less weight reduces the stress on weight-bearing joints like the knees, hips, and spine, which can decrease pain and the risk of arthritis.
Stronger Muscles: As you lose weight, you may gain muscle mass through exercise, increasing overall strength and endurance.

4. Improved Respiratory Health

Better Lung Function: Less excess weight can lead to improved lung function, making breathing easier during physical activity and reducing the risk of conditions like sleep apnea.
Less Snoring: Reducing fat around the neck can relieve pressure on the airways, leading to reduced snoring and improved sleep.

5. More Energy and Vitality

Increased Stamina: Carrying less weight can make physical activities like walking, running, or exercising feel easier, helping you stay more active and engaged in daily activities.
Improved Sleep Quality: Weight loss often helps alleviate sleep disorders like sleep apnea and insomnia, leading to more restful, restorative sleep.

Dr Des: Focus on YOU – Generalized Anxiety Disorder.

•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D):
Persistent and excessive worry about various everyday things like work, health, or family, often lasting for at least six months.
• Panic Disorder:
Recurrent, unexpected panic attacks and a persistent fear of having more attacks. Panic attacks are sudden periods of intense fear that trigger physical symptoms like a pounding heart, sweating, or shortness of breath.
• Social Anxiety Disorder:
Intense fear and worry about social situations where the person feels they might be judged, humiliated, or embarrassed.
• Agoraphobia:
Fear and avoidance of situations or places that might cause panic, such as being in crowds, using public transportation, or leaving home.
• Separation Anxiety Disorder:
Excessive fear or worry about being separated from people with whom the person has a strong emotional bond. This can be a normal part of development for children, but becomes a disorder when the feelings are extreme or inappropriate.
• Specific Phobias:
Intense, irrational fear of a specific object or situation, such as heights, spiders, or flying, that leads to significant distress or avoidance.
• Selective Mutism:

Consistent inability to speak in specific social situations, even though the person can speak comfortably in other settings. This primarily affects children.

Dr Des: Communicating with your Doctor.

Keep your discussion focused, making sure to cover your main questions and concerns, your symptoms and how they impact your life. Ask for clarification if you don't understand what you have been told or if you still have questions. Ask for explanations of treatment goals and side effects.
